The Biggest QA Trends for 2025

The demand for high-quality software delivery and rising user expectations heavily influence QA practices. These trends will dominate the QA industry in 2025:

  1. Hyperautomation in Testing
    QA automation is evolving. Hyperautomation integrates AI, ML, and robotic process automation (RPA), allowing QA teams to scale and accelerate testing processes. These tools drastically reduce manual testing efforts, resulting in quicker time-to-market without sacrificing quality.

  2. Shift-Left and Shift-Right Testing
    Organizations are adopting shift-left (early testing during development) and shift-right (post-deployment monitoring and analysis) strategies for superior software quality. These complementary approaches ensure risk mitigation and user satisfaction throughout the software lifecycle.

  3. Predictive Testing with AI
    Leveraging historical data, AI-powered predictive testing identifies potential software errors before they occur. This proactive methodology prevents downtime and enhances development efficiency.

  4. Intelligent Automated Testing Frameworks AI-integrated frameworks streamline test script adaptation, even as software requirements evolve. These dynamic and intelligent systems reduce human intervention while improving testing precision.

  5. Cloud-Native and Microservices Testing
    As cloud-native solutions and microservices architecture become mainstream, QA teams prioritize tools for testing the scalability, reliability, and security of distributed systems to deliver seamless services.

  6. Continuous Testing in DevOps Pipelines
    Continuous testing ensures quality without compromising speed, a key demand in agile environments. Organizations in 2025 will intensify reliance on continuous testing to maintain efficiency across DevOps cycles.

Future-Focused QA: Predictive Testing Powered by AI

Predictive analytics is a game-changer for QA teams aiming to deliver impeccable software. By analyzing historical test data, predictive testing anticipates vulnerabilities, enabling teams to avert issues early in the development lifecycle. This method boosts productivity and reduces defect leakage rates.

For instance, predictive AI tools can prioritize critical test cases for each new software build, saving resources and time. Integrating Machine Learning into QA Practices

While AI drives predictive testing, Machine Learning (ML) shapes the core of modern test automation. ML tools learn application behavior to adapt testing practices for evolving designs and use cases. Key benefits include:

  1. Self-Healing Test Scripts
    ML identifies changes in software, allowing test scripts to auto-adjust without direct intervention, eradicating downtime due to script failures.

  2. Smarter Test Data Management
    ML generates diverse, synthetic data that reflects real-world trends, ensuring more thorough test coverage.

  3. Advanced Defect Tracking
    By analyzing logs and historical testing patterns, ML detects and preempts hidden errors, resolving root causes while simplifying defect tracking tasks for QA teams.

Organizations leveraging ML will achieve faster, more accurate testing, creating software that scales effectively with minimal risk of failure.
